Shel Goldstein is a Canadian actress intermittently active in politics.
She was born in
Toronto , and was educated atMcGill University andYork University . While continuing to play roles infilm ,television ,theatre , andadvertising , she stood for the now-defunctNational Party of Canada in Willowdale for the 1993 election. The party's key policy was opposition to theCanada-U.S. Free Trade Agreement , a cause that Goldstein strongly supports. Following the collapse of the National Party, she transferred her support to the Green Party. She ran as its candidate forEglinton—Lawrence in the 2004 federal election, and received 1,924 votes (4.09%) for a fourth-place finish against Liberal incumbentJoseph Volpe .External links
